Information minister says election date set for Feb 8 and there should be no doubt about it

Caretaker Minister for Information and Broadcasting Murtaza Solangi has expressed satisfaction that the country is heading towards economic stability.

The Information Minister said general elections will be held on the 8th of February and there should be no doubt about it.

Addressing a news conference along with Balochistan Information Minister Jan Achakzai in Quetta today, he pointed out that the Pakistan Stock Exchange crossed sixty-six thousand points today during trading, while the dollar also depreciated.

Quoting the report of Bloomberg, the Minister said Pakistan is on the agenda of IMF board on the eleventh of next month.

He reaffirmed the government’s commitment to ensure free, fair and transparent elections in the country. He said it is our responsibility to extend full facilitation to the Election Commission of Pakistan.

Responding to a question, the Information Minister said the state media will be modernized and its capacity will be increased.

He expressed confidence that the state media would come at par with the world’s best broadcasters and its future is not bleak, but bright.
